Waste of a good concept

This movie suffers from the typical modern Chinese movie affliction : it lets the CGI take centre stage and ultimately the story suffers for it.

While the CGI is good, it has no story to tell. It is just eye candy and nothing more. What is more disheartening is that this movie had a great story concept. It would have been better to let the story lead and decide where and when CGI is needed to enhance the tale. As it is, the movie felt like a collection of scenes that showcases CGI magic that does little to better the story.

Without revealing too much detail and risking a spoiler, this movie is a re-imagining of the classic Chinese ghost story of Nie Xiaoqian and Ning Chaichen. However, I felt that it spent too much time with Po Songling (Jackie Chan) rather than to develop the relationship between Xiaoqian and Chaichen. The first third of the movie can be shortened as it spent too much time introducing Po Songling and Yan Fei; who is totally unnecessary as a character here.

Time would have been better spent to tell us more about the backstory of Xiaoqian and Chaichen which was reduced to an animated flashback segment lasting about 3 minutes.

The acting in the movie was so-so. Jackie Chan didn't look like he was giving his best. The rest of the cast were decent but the lead roles deserved so much more. Sad to say more time were dedicated to bringing in CGI characters like the pig demon and the thousand-hand demon than to develop the chemistry and/or conflict between Xiaoqian and Chaichen.

One can't help but to wonder how much better this movie could have been if enough care was given to tell a story rather than to showcase some CGI imagery.
